I am planning on picking up a 10/22 soon and would like to set it up with ghost rings. I have looked at the xs sights, williams,& tech sights. Are there any others out there I am missing? I am looking for low profile and durable. Thanks for the help.

I put these on a 10/22: http://www.tech-sights.com/ruger3.htmWith the two apetures, you can have a ghost and a finer apeture.

With the Williams, you can get an adjustable iris accessory. Gives you the ability to go from fine accuracy to fast acquisition and all points between without removing anything.
